Analysis

In 2020, human capital per capita in Armenia stood at 20,756 current US$.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 5.9% on the previous year and up 38.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, human capital per capita in Armenia peaked at 22,061 current US$ in 2019 and was at its lowest, 2,542 current US$, in 1995.

That places Armenia 77th out of 150 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
